BUSINESS ANALYST II
The Marvin Group is a leading defense contractor specializing in the development and manufacturing of military aerospace and vehicle systems. Based in Southern California, the company comprises Marvin Engineering (MEC), Marvin Test Solutions (MTS), and Marvin Land Systems (MLS), serving the Department of Defense and global allies for over 60 years.
About the role
The Business Analyst (BA) will report directly to the IT Application Manager, providing Super User and end-user support for operational issues, configuration, enhancements, and key projects within SAP. The role involves delivering best-practice solutions, training, and process improvements across one or more functional areas, including:
- Contracts & Business Development
- Program Management
- Operations (backup for primary analyst)
- Depot
- Finance
The BA should be an expert in one or more of the following business processes:
- Order-to-cash process (SAP SD Module: contract, delivery, billing)
- Production planning process (SAP PP module)
- Depot process (SAP MRO process)
- Finance and Controlling processes (SAP FI/CO module)
